Caesar Country is a love letter to Canada by way of one cocktail-our cocktail-the Caesar. In this stunning book, Aaron Harowitz and Zack Silverman-co-founders of Walter Craft Caesar-take you on a deep and detailed dive through the art and science of Caesar making. They share a compelling collection of cocktail and food recipes, including contributions from some of Canada's top bartenders and chefs, showcasing the countless ways to reinterpret the classic Caesar. Caesar Country is inspired by travels across Canada-the people met, places seen, drinks enjoyed-and seamlessly weaves together the Caesar's history, evolution,and the innovators behind it, to create a visual and culinary celebration of the country it calls home.

Aaron Harowitz and Zack Silverman grew up together in Richmond, British Columbia in the 1980s. Many years later, in 2013, they co-founded Walter Craft Caesar with the simple goal of reimagining Canada's national cocktail. As a result, it's entirely possible they've tried more Caesars than just about anyone anywhere. This is their first book.
